When looking at taxi fares, a ride in Salvador averages 0.78 GBP, which is 2% less expensive than in Sao Paulo, where the average fare is 0.80 GBP. This price difference reflects varying transportation costs in different regions, often influenced by factors such as local demand, fuel prices, and regulatory fees.
Train tickets in Salvador are 3% more expensive compared to Sao Paulo. The price in Salvador is 0.69 GBP, whereas in Sao Paulo, it's 0.67 GBP.This price difference may make travel more expensive, particularly for frequent commuters or those mindful of their budget.
Regarding the price of a meal, in Salvador, it is 4.12 GBP. This is 23% lower than the meal price in Sao Paulo, where it costs 5.32 GBP.
For coffee lovers, the price is 21% lower in Salvador, with an average cost of 1.18 GBP, while in Sao Paulo, coffee is 1.50 GBP.
